Abstract

A series of biomimetic collagen films was prepared. The texture and topological structure of collagen films were studied by polarizing optical microscopy ( POM ) , scanning electron microscopy ( SEM ) and atomic force microscopy (AFM). The relationship between collagen membranes and 3T3 cells was studied by 3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yltetrazolium bromide(MTT) method and cytoskeleton fluorescence staining. The results show that the collagen liquid crystal (LC) membranes present continuously twisting orientations in cholesteric phases characterized by typical series of arced patterns. Compared with the non-LC membranes , LC membranes not only could promote the cell' s adhesion and proliferation, but also the LC topological structure had a contact guide effect to 3T3 cells.
